- Chicago Bears scored 59 points in a 59-37 victory over the Carolina Panthers, producing a combined 96 points that set the record for the highest-scoring Week 1 game in NFL history.
- Caleb Williams accounted for four total touchdowns to lead the Bears' record-setting offensive performance in the season opener.
Why it matters: The Bears set the all-time Week 1 scoring record with 59 points and 96 combined against Carolina, with Caleb Williams producing four touchdowns in what stands as the franchise's most explosive season-opening output on record.
